    The Colin Powell School for Civic and Global Leadership at the City College of New York (CCNY) is a nonpartisan educational, training, and research center named for its founder, Colin Powell, a graduate of CCNY. The school is located at 160 Convent Avenue, in NAC building 6/141 on the CCNY campus, in West Harlem. The current dean is Andrew Rich.

    v. t. e. On February 5, 2003, the Secretary of State of the United States Colin Powell gave a PowerPoint presentation [ 1 ][ 2 ] to the United Nations Security Council. He explained the rationale for the Iraq War which would start on March 19, 2003 with the invasion of Iraq. The content of the presentation was based on unreliable evidence.
